Stuart Green is an Associate Lecturer at Buckinghamshire New University (BNU), where he teaches across modules in sustainability, finance, and economics within the BSc (Hons) Aviation Management with Commercial Pilot Training programme. His academic role is supported by formal recognition through Associate Fellowship of the Higher Education Authority, earned in 2020.
His educational background includes a degree from Manchester University and a PGDip in Tourism (specializing in air transport) from Manchester Polytechnic. He later completed an Executive MBA at Ashridge Business School, focusing on sustainability in air transport.
Stuart's research interests center on sustainable aviation, transport economics, and aviation management. His professional experience deeply informs his teaching, particularly in commercial pilot training and aviation operations.
